Xamarin.Droid - 无法加载程序集System.Web.Mvc

时间:2017-12-06 20:49:13

标签: xamarin

我在StackOverflow上看到了关于它的多个帖子/问题但是关于ASP.NET

我得到以下内容:

  

/Library/Frameworks/Mono.framework/External/xbuild/Xamarin/Android/Xamarin.Android.Common.targets(2,2):错误:加载程序集时出现异常:System.IO.FileNotFoundException:无法加载程序集' System.Web.Mvc,Version = 2.0.0.0,Culture = neutral,PublicKeyToken = 31bf3856ad364e35'。也许它在Mono for Android配置文件中不存在?   文件名:' System.Web.Mvc.dll'     at Java.Interop.Tools.Cecil.DirectoryAssemblyResolver.Resolve(Mono.Cecil.AssemblyNameReference reference,Mono.Cecil.ReaderParameters参数)[0x00099]在/ Users / builder / data / lanes / 5749 / 9cfa7836 / source / xamarin-android /外部/ Java.Interop / src目录/ Java.Interop.Tools.Cecil / Java.Interop.Tools.Cecil / DirectoryAssemblyResolver.cs:229     在/Users/builder/data/lanes/5749/9cfa7836/source/xamarin-android/external/Java.Interop/src中的Java.Interop.Tools.Cecil.DirectoryAssemblyResolver.Resolve(Mono.Cecil.AssemblyNameReference reference)[0x00000] /Java.Interop.Tools.Cecil/Java.Interop.Tools.Cecil/DirectoryAssemblyResolver.cs:179     at Xamarin.Android.Tasks.ResolveAssemblies.AddAssemblyReferences(Java.Interop.Tools.Cecil.DirectoryAssemblyResolver resolver,System.Collections.Generic.ICollection`1 [T] assemblies,Mono.Cecil.AssemblyDefinition assembly,System.Boolean topLevel)[0x0015c ]< 998d78d5ee6d46b491b77aff8eeaf856&gt ;:0     at Xamarin.Android.Tasks.ResolveAssemblies.Execute(Java.Interop.Tools.Cecil.DirectoryAssemblyResolver resolver)[0x001c7] in< 998d78d5ee6d46b491b77aff8eeaf856>:0(NightLine.Droid)

现在有趣的一点是,我的项目并不是一个所有的ASP.NET项目x)首先,到底是什么?

我播放了这段视频:https://channel9.msdn.com/Shows/XamarinShow/Snack-Pack-15-Upgrading-to-XamarinForms-to-NET-Standard

我将.NET Standard项目升级到2.0。我的Android目标是8.0和编译器。我尝试升级所有的Xamarin.Android。*包但没有成功......

有什么想法吗?

由于

0 个答案:

没有答案